Finding the Best Keywords for Your Website
When optimizing your website, start with keyword research. Keywords are the terms or phrases people type into search engines to find content related to their interests. For Islamic websites, these terms might include “Quran lessons online,” “halal lifestyle blog,” or “Islamic charity.”
Use tools like Google Keyword Planner, SEMrush, or Ubersuggest to find relevant terms. When selecting keywords, focus on terms that align with your goals and what your audience is searching for.
For example, if your goal is to attract visitors searching for prayer resources, targeting a keyword like “Islamic prayer guides” can work effectively. On the other hand, those offering products like Islamic wall art could benefit from targeting keywords like “Islamic home decor.”
Include Keywords Naturally
Once you’ve identified your keywords, incorporate them strategically throughout your website — but don’t overuse them. Keyword stuffing can hurt your rankings. Instead, focus on writing content that flows naturally while including the keywords in headings, titles, meta tags, image alt texts, and post URLs.
On-Page Optimization for Islamic Websites
On-page optimization refers to adjustments you make directly on your site to improve its ranking in search engines. Here’s what to focus on, keeping Islamic websites in mind.
1. High-Quality Content Relevant to the Islamic Community
Search engines prioritize content that is informative, engaging, and relevant. For Islamic websites, your content could include blogs about Quranic topics, videos of Islamic scholars, halal food recipes, or tips for daily prayers.
Use tools like Grammarly to ensure your writing is clear and professional. Focus on specific topics your readers care about, and break your content into sections for easier reading.
2. Meta Titles and Descriptions
These are the first things users see on search engine results pages. Your meta titles and descriptions should feature your targeted keywords without sounding robotic. For example, for “Islamic prayer time tracking,” a meta title could be:
“Accurate Islamic Prayer Times & Tools | [Your Website Name]”
This gives information while being SEO-friendly.
3. Mobile Responsiveness
A significant percentage of users browse Islamic content on their mobile phones. Make sure your website is mobile-friendly, with fast load times and easily navigable content. Google prioritizes mobile-first indexing, which means that mobile-friendliness directly impacts your rankings.
4. Image Optimization
Many Islamic websites feature beautiful Islamic art, calligraphy, and images. While visual content enhances your site, images also provide an opportunity to improve SEO. Use descriptive alt tags like “Downloadable Ramadan calendar” to help search engines understand your images.

Off-Page SEO Tips
Off-page SEO refers to actions taken outside your website that can improve your rankings, such as backlinks and social media promotion.
Backlinks from Trusted Islamic Websites
Link building is essential for establishing your site’s authority. Reach out to popular Islamic blogs, e-commerce platforms, or scholars’ websites and ask for backlinks to your content. Creating high-value content like free Islamic course guides or interactive tools (like a zakat calculator) encourages others to link to you.
Social Media Engagement
Use plat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and YouTube to connect with your audience. Share your blogs, playlists, or e-commerce offers and make sure each post includes a link back to your website. For example, a site focusing on halal recipes can post videos of the cooking process while redirecting viewers to get the full recipe on their website.
Local SEO for Mosques and Events
If your site represents a local mosque or Islamic center, leverage local SEO. Create a Google My Business profile to ensure your location shows up in searches like “mosques near me” or “Islamic community events nearby.”

Tracking and Improving Your Performance
No SEO strategy is complete without tracking your progress. Use tools like Google Analytics or Ahrefs to see how your pages are performing. Which keywords are driving traffic? Are users spending time on your pages or leaving quickly?
By continually refining your tactics, you can build a site that consistently ranks higher and brings value to your audience.
